
java如何遍历最后一个元素
用户关注问题
如何在Java中访问集合的最后一个元素?
在操作Java集合时,我想获取集合中的最后一个元素,有哪些方法可以实现这一操作?
使用索引或特定方法获取集合最后一个元素
可以通过集合的大小减1作为索引,使用get方法获取最后一个元素。例如,对于ArrayList,使用list.get(list.size() - 1)来访问最后一个元素。另外,某些集合类如LinkedList提供了getLast()方法,可以直接获取最后一个元素。
遍历Java数组时,如何处理最后一个元素以避免越界?
我在遍历Java数组时担心访问最后一个元素时会导致数组越界,如何安全地遍历包括最后一个元素的数组?
使用循环中的边界条件确保安全访问
在遍历数组时,设置循环条件为i < array.length,确保索引不会超过数组大小。最后一个元素的索引是array.length - 1,通过这种方式能安全访问数组中的所有元素,包括最后一个。
Java中如何遍历并获取最后一个元素后做特殊处理?
在遍历集合时,我需要对最后一个元素执行不同的操作,有什么好的实现方式?
通过条件判断实现对最后一个元素的特殊处理
在遍历过程中,可以通过索引判断是否为最后一个元素。例如,在使用for循环时,判断当前索引是否等于集合大小减1。如果是则执行特殊操作,否则执行常规处理,这样就能针对最后一个元素进行不同的处理。